The Consultation Letters of Dr William Cullen (1710-1790) at the Royal College of Physicians of Edinburgh

 

[ID:6276] From: Dr Alexander Henry Halliday (Halyday, Halleday) / To: Dr William Cullen (Professor Cullen) / Regarding: Mrs Cunningham (Patient) / 1 April 1787 / (Incoming)

Letter from Dr Halliday, reporting the case history of a widow Lady aged forty seven, with a 'delicate feeling frame', and a long-standing vaginal discharge.
